What is A4 Paper?

A4 paper is specified by the ISO 216 requirement and measures 210 mm x 297 mm (8.27 inches x 11.69 inches). It is one of the most typically utilized paper sizes internationally and is favored for its balance of size, usability, and versatility. Normal usages consist of printing files, creating reports, and producing marketing materials.

Secret Characteristics of A4 Paper:

CharacteristicDescription
Size210 mm x 297 mm
Aspect Ratio1: √ 2
Typical Weight70-100 gsm (grams per square meter)
UsesPrinting, copying, letterheads, sales brochures

The A4 Paper Supply Chain

Understanding the A4 paper supply chain is vital for comprehending how this commonly utilized resource is produced and distributed. The supply chain can be broken down into a number of phases:

  1. Raw Material Sourcing: The primary raw product for paper production is wood pulp, obtained from trees. Sustainable forestry practices are essential to stabilize the environmental impact.
  2. Manufacturing: The raw wood pulp is processed into sheets of paper, which are then cut into A4 sizes. This procedure can also involve recycling paper to develop new A4 sheets.
  3. Circulation: Once produced, A4 paper is distributed to various markets, consisting of retail, corporate, and universities.
  4. End Use: A4 paper is used throughout sectors for printing, copying, and document creation.

Q: Are there various types of A4 paper available?A: Yes, A4 paper comes in numerous types, consisting of shiny, matte,recycled, and specialty papers created for specific functions like picture printing. Q: How is A4 paper various from Letter size?A: A4 paper measures 210 mm x 297 mm, while Letter size steps 216 mm x 279 mm. A4 is more frequently utilized outside North America
